首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将React-Select与Rest API(远程数据)集成

React-Select是一个流行的React库,用于创建可定制的下拉选择框。它提供了丰富的功能和灵活的配置选项,可以与各种数据源集成,包括远程数据源。

要将React-Select与Rest API集成,需要以下步骤:

  1. 安装React-Select库:使用npm或yarn安装React-Select库。
  2. 安装React-Select库:使用npm或yarn安装React-Select库。
  3. 导入React-Select组件:在需要使用React-Select的组件中,导入React-Select组件。
  4. 导入React-Select组件:在需要使用React-Select的组件中,导入React-Select组件。
  5. 创建一个状态变量来存储从API获取的数据:使用useState钩子创建一个状态变量,用于存储从API获取的数据。
  6. 创建一个状态变量来存储从API获取的数据:使用useState钩子创建一个状态变量,用于存储从API获取的数据。
  7. 使用useEffect钩子调用API并更新状态变量:使用useEffect钩子在组件加载时调用API,并将返回的数据更新到状态变量中。
  8. 使用useEffect钩子调用API并更新状态变量:使用useEffect钩子在组件加载时调用API,并将返回的数据更新到状态变量中。
  9. 在上面的代码中,将API_URL替换为实际的API地址。
  10. 配置React-Select组件:在组件的JSX中,使用Select组件并配置props。
  11. 配置React-Select组件:在组件的JSX中,使用Select组件并配置props。
  12. 在上面的代码中,将options属性设置为状态变量options的值,以将API返回的数据传递给React-Select组件。

通过以上步骤,React-Select与Rest API的集成就完成了。当组件加载时,它将调用API获取数据,并将数据传递给React-Select组件进行展示和选择。

React-Select的优势在于其灵活性和可定制性。它提供了丰富的配置选项,可以满足各种需求。它还支持异步加载数据,可以处理大量的选项。React-Select还具有良好的用户体验,提供了搜索、多选、标签等功能。

在腾讯云的产品中,可以使用腾讯云的云函数(Serverless Cloud Function)来实现API的部署和调用。云函数是一种无服务器计算服务,可以方便地部署和运行代码,无需关心服务器的管理和维护。您可以使用云函数来托管和调用您的API,并将返回的数据传递给React-Select组件。

腾讯云云函数产品介绍链接地址:腾讯云云函数

请注意,以上答案仅供参考,具体的集成步骤和腾讯云产品选择可能因实际需求而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【译】Graphql, gRPC和端对端类型检验

StackPath最近发布了新的门户网站,它让用户可以一站式地配置我们所提供的服务(CDN,WAF, DNS以及Monitoring)。这个项目涉及到整合不同的数据源,以及一些现有和全新的系统。虽然我们认为开发效率的优先级在一个新启动的项目中是最高的,但我们还是希望在保证足够快的开发进度的前提下,尽可能早地做一些能够保证产品长期稳定运行的技术投资,以便我们能够持续不断地在一个健壮的基础设施上添加新的功能特性。最终我们选择了Apollo GraphQL+gRPC+React+TypeScript这样一套技术栈,并对使用它们的结果感到满意。在这篇博客中,我们会解释为何选择这些技术栈,并通过一个简单的示例项目进行论述。

02
领券